ANDE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2014 in Review

213 of the 3,446 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Andersons Inc (ANDE) for Q3 2014, worth a combined $1.33B — up 19% from $1.12B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 44 funds opened new ANDE positions and 17 closed out — a net gain of 27 holders — while 55 added to existing stakes and 86 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Two Sigma Investments, opening a new position worth an estimated $9.45M. The largest seller was Norges Bank, cutting an estimated $16.4M.
